International Touring Car

“The technical side makes it very interesting, as a lot of time and effort is being put in. Time will tell if the concept of having a world championship will work. It’s difficult for me to judge at the moment, if another manufacturer would be interested in the ITC. The next two years will tell. ” Frank Williams, 1996

Read more
1 2